Christmas and Easter breaks are challenging. There’s always a no-show who “forgot to mention” that they’ll be at Aunt Sadie’s and miss the meet. Usually it involves a leg on a relay.

Luckily, the Sprint Medley wasn’t effected, as we felt we had the horses to win it. Rahsheed Wright (53.0), Shamere Dunswell (23.2) Matt Selverian (24.6) and Cam Christopher (2:03.3) proved us correct. We were never headed as 3:42.85 was a full 5 seconds up on second place.

Later on, Dunswell became our second 200M state qualifier, winning his heat in 23.26 placing him 3rd over-all.

The 4×8 produced some nice PRs in placing second. Soph Justin Ryan kept us in the mix leading off with an indoor PR of 2:10, Cam took over the lead with his 2:02, and Trey Hippensteal’s 2:17 (3 sec. PR) 3rd leg gave Ben Hoyer enough to work with as he stopped the clock in 2:09. (8:40.41)

Other medalists included 4th place finishes from Ben Hoyer in the mile with an indoor PR of 4:46.58,  Rahsheed Wright’s 52.10 (MOC) 400M and a 5th from Justin Cooper in the Shot put (44-6.5)
